This is a brief summary of the job duties:

This position is a self-motivated and primarily self-directed position responsible for the daily and continued care of County owned grounds. The incumbent is responsible for the maintenance and repair of all grounds maintenance equipment and for the development and execution of all preventative maintenance schedules. This position is responsible for all aspects of grounds maintenance including snow and ice removal, care of lawns, trees and flower bed maintenance. This position is a self-motivated and primarily self-directed position, working primarily outdoors with a weather dependent flexible schedule including weekday, weekend, evening and night work. Notifies other Facility Management staff what duties need completion. May assist with custodian duties as needed.

These are the qualifications we are seeking:

  • High School diploma or equivalent required. Associate degree in urban forestry preferred.
  • Three years’ experience in landscaping, equipment operation, construction, or similar work environment preferred.
  • Experience in developing and maintaining Preventative Maintenance Programs preferred.
  • Must possess or obtain a Wisconsin Pesticide Applicators License within twelve months of employment.
  • Valid driver’s license required.
  • Must be at least 18 years old.
  • Must pass chainsaw certification training.
  • Must pass Caregiver and FBI criminal background check which will be conducted by the Portage County Sheriff’s department. Must not have any felony convictions.
